Transaction 166cf022567d01afd31d0984a172eaf85c6d74526d9d78f30ab5f80357343e47
1 Input
1 Output
-
166cf022567d01afd31d0984a172eaf85c6d74526d9d78f30ab5f80357343e47:0
- value
- 18429534
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 51ab9c6e60b71a55d21995ffb1c8b764c45520a9 OP_EQUAL
- address
- 398rEpwoBPax8SgqhwJcNwc1yXgwmfhXfH